    Product Overview
    The PSC Tool Holder Series features a unique Polygon Shank Conical design, which ensures superior rigidity and minimal deflection during machining. This design maximizes the clamping force between the tool holder and spindle, preventing vibrations that can affect the accuracy and surface finish of the machined parts. Built to the ISO 26623 standard, the series is compatible with various CNC machines, offering excellent flexibility for manufacturers looking to streamline their tooling systems.

    The PSC Tool Holder Series is available in a range of configurations, including modular turning holders, shrink-fit tool holders, and hybrid turn-mill holders, making it a versatile choice for different machining operations. Whether used for milling, turning, drilling, or reaming, the tool holders are designed to perform optimally in both static and live tooling applications, providing an all-in-one solution for multi-task machining.

    Key Features & Benefits
    Polygon Shank Conical Interface: The PSC interface significantly increases torsional rigidity by providing a secure connection between the tool holder and spindle, leading to reduced vibration and deflection during cutting. This results in improved machining accuracy and longer tool life.

    Precision Clamping Technology: The shrink-fit clamping system delivers uniform clamping force, minimizing run-out and ensuring the tool holder maintains a firm grip on the tool. This guarantees precision and stability in high-speed and high-torque operations.

    High-Speed Machining: Designed to operate at speeds up to 40,000 RPM, the PSC Tool Holder Series excels in high-speed applications, ensuring consistent and accurate cutting performance. This feature is particularly beneficial for fine finishing and precision cutting tasks.

    Versatility Across Applications: The PSC Tool Holder Series is highly adaptable, supporting static and driven tooling for a wide range of applications, including turning, milling, drilling, and reaming. Its flexibility makes it a valuable tool for manufacturers working with a diverse range of machining operations.
